Pac-mania v4.2 w/high score keeper.

zardOz2 - Custom level - from Android
v2: Ghost now choses a random path at every fork without backtracking.
v2.1 :( my test with 4 ghosts was very slooow... pac-man may have to wait for 1.5
v2.2: lag test with four ghosts... running at 2/3 speed over here, improved the code but it's still not good enough.
v2.3: Giant plastic box screenshot thing, auto-absorbs on start for lower memory usage.
v3.0: Player character added, movement only currently.. I decided that pac-man lacked character and made a new guy called "Happy" after my friends dog who just passed;)
v3.1: Happy must now avoid the ghosts! He still can't score yet.
v3.1.1: added a temporary "stay alive as long as possible" score counter for something to addict you with. 3.1.2, made the ghosts start slower and get faster over time.

v4.0: Sfx, edible dots, new scoring system... Score 1 point every 60 bits you stay alive, 1 point for a dot and 25 for clearing the board...
v4.1: High score keeper added, will track even if you close the game. Fixed missing dot. New screenshot.
v4.1.1: +300 score error if you died on the 60th bit fixed...
v4.2: Power-ups, speed boost(yellow arrows) and stun ghosts(red arrows)

Views: 12495 Downloads: 3995 Unique objects: 15 Total objects: 369

  • ssssssssse: Bad
  • ssssssssse: Bad
  • TheBossMan: Always I die in one of the corners
  • TheBossMan: 186
  • qwertyah: 874
  • principiafreak300: Like 50
  • varmor: 145
  • zardOz2: @PeterZ: see "high score keeper" will work for any game where the score never decreases.
  • PeterZ: Just realized that this level had kept my high score for ages - that is like a month or so.
  • Pman5556: 392.00
  • Manny: @zardOz: I know the names of all the ghosts! The orange one is Clyde, the pink one is pinky, the red one is blinky, and the blue one is inky.
  • spaceship1880: 382
  • zardOz2: @Blood: good score! Nobody has even come close to my best of 435 yet.
  • Blood: 202
  • zardOz2: @Manny: Keep trying! My best is 3 times cleared!
  • Manny: 2 left!
  • Demon666: @keeghan: ..........i think i just found a use for my giant killer plant lmfao
  • zardOz2: @keeghan: Ive never played that game sorry
  • keeghan: @zardOz: can you make a plants vs zombies level using luas?
  • Jason: I needed one more dot to win
  • ricardito08: @Manny: Why the heck you told your age? I'll excuse you for this time. Welcome to Principia though!
  • zardOz2: @davetheguy: cleared the board? There is no way to "win" besides beating your old high score... it's pretty hard but Im suprised how low the scores are.
  • davetheguy: I won!
  • Blood: Score 191
  • zardOz2: @TechZ: thanks man, You inspired me to quit stalling and make an "all lua" game
  • TechZ2124: Really great level and awesome upgrades ! The last time I saw it it was only with two ghosts and no characters Lol. I could not get more than 132, even after trying at least 10 times ;)
  • zardOz2: @Manny: Im old enough to be your dad's friend!
  • Manny: zardOz, remember, it's me many. How old are you? I'm 7 remember?
  • shantanuaryan67: Only 4 dots were left :(
  • Manny: zardOz, oh man it's bed time! I need to go to bed at 7:30! I always stay up 'till 10:45! LOL! I like writing that well can we keep writing at 7:15 tomorrow or later? I have to go to school at 8:25! I come home at 2:55 but we can keep writing at 4:30 okay? You are an aawesome dude!
  • Manny: I keep writing!
  • Manny: My dad just spilled poisen! LOL!
  • Manny: zardOz, keep writing it's fun to write with new people even without seeing them!
  • Manny: zardOz, I've had Principia for a while. The reason I used a comment here is because I love this level! Will you please let us edit it? I'll put music in it. You just need to click publish again and click on the first check box!
  • zardOz2: @Manny: thanks Manny
  • Manny: Thank you zardOz! I like it! I can use any object but some in the logic gates and the lua script. You are really good with them. I enters a platform climber just now but it didn't get in the contest. I love your amazingly awesome levels!
  • zardOz2: @Manny: hi manny, welcome to principia. Only 7 wow, principia is a tough game to learn good luck.
  • Manny: zardOz, I'm new my user name is Manny. Don't laugh at a goofy name. I'm only age 7 my dad used his email address. I do have an email adress. I have to to get games. My dad forgot it and didn't want to walk 5 meters to get the paper he wrote my address on. LOL! LOL! LOL!
  • marat500: 98
  • that guy2: Science!
  • zardOz2: @that guy: an allergen is anything which causes your immune system to overreact and release histimene, generally it causes people moving from dark to light to sneeze or break into a rash, blurry vision etc. 40% of people have some level of photosensitivity.
  • that guy2: *material. I hate this stupid teeny tiny keyboard.
  • that guy2: @zardOz: vitamin D? Sunlight is not a msterial.
  • zardOz2: @that guy: just giving him some character... also he has a sunlight allergy.
  • that guy2: 92. What's with the hat?
  • zardOz2: @golden: the lag is almost all from the ghost and pacman pattern... the lines are very minor, need about 600 lines for lag
  • Golden: @zardOz: use platflorms instead sprite to make less lag
  • Golden: 202
  • Ronan: 71
  • zardOz2: @Demon666: I think this one will stay mini... it's a pretty solid mini game as is... I have some ideas for a mega version but I think I'm gonna wait for the add_static_sprites feature.
  • Demon666: still waiting on a larger map lol.
  • Demon666: it's alot easier on pc since I can feel out the buttons but on my phone I just crash into walls and die.
  • zardOz2: @pajlada: @Demon666: here's my stagegies: start in one of the four directions and turn just in front of one of the ghosts, then try to get 2 corners clear right off the start. Dont go after the powerups if tthey are too far away or dangerous. Follow ghosts when possible especially when they go in groups around a corner. The first powerup will pop after 800 bits, the second at 2500 and third at 4200
  • pajlada: @Demon666: I feel the same, I can't get more than 100 points before running into one of the scary ghosts. :(
  • burning_potato: 182
  • Demon666: I just realized that I'm horrible at pacman lmfao.
  • pajlada: @zardOz: Picture should update properly now, thanks. :-)
  • zardOz2: @rom1k: thanks for the highlight! FYI the big feature picture has the current screenshot and the second smaller feature screenshot has an older pic... the older pics are also on the "top" page.
  • zardOz2: @Nighthawk: thx for the report, Its hard for me to tell if it move too fast since I can only play in slomo...@incrazyboyy: @jetboy007: thx for playing! 417 is my best now... @golden: no rush Im gonna start something new
  • incrazyboyy: Add a scoreboard
  • incrazyboyy: Yay 223
  • jetboy007: 121
  • Nighthawk: 216 now, still works smoothly :)
  • Golden: @zardOz: it be less a week to match it
  • zardOz2: @Rubicon: yes, but I kinda designed this one to be a closed box... I will need to redo all the codes for the next version now that I have it down pretty well.. @golden: sure that would be cool!
  • Rubicon2: Very nice level ZardOz, I have no lag on my phone, is it possible to make an open doorway and have Pac man morph in from the other side?
  • Golden: I played pac-man often ;)
  • Golden: @zardOz: do you want me to make a dying, game over sound effecs?
  • sjoerd19992: 268 is my best ;)
  • Ctjet: Over 9000, jk, 152
  • Demon666: @zardOz: looking forward to it.
  • zardOz2: In retrospect I should have waited to add the High score keeper since I may have to modify it and you will lose your scores.
  • zardOz2: @Demon666: :) It's pretty tough, but there are some strategies like following a ghost around corners... should be a bit easier once I get some power-ups balanced
  • Demon666: got 93 lol theres no room for error with such a small space.
  • zardOz2: @Alfajim: thanks for playing:)
  • Alfajim: Its coming along nicely. Amazing level. :)
  • ricardito08: 155
  • Wkmz: 210 cleared once, almost second :p
  • zardOz2: 397, three times cleared
  • zardOz2: @golden: It's already laging pretty bad for me and others and I still need to add a few things...
  • Golden: @zardOz: dot later, make map bigger
  • Golden: @zardOz: 93 my best
  • Wkmz: Great update but it's lagging very much
  • zardOz2: @Nighthawk: @golden: all new scoring and near finished state... old records are now useless again! Clear the high scores.
  • Nighthawk: works awesome on pc, got 406! nice!
  • Golden: @zardOz: trying to beat you
  • Golden: @zardOz: 473
  • zardOz2: @golden: thx g... it might be easier for me due to the slomo lag I have
  • Golden: @zardOz: BTW nice pacman
  • Golden: 259 ;)
  • zardOz2: @FirePhenixFire: 558 is my best, corners are dangerous!
  • FirePhenixFire: Make the map a bit bigger I keep on get conner trapped
  • x32g: Yeah!
  • zardOz2: @x32g: oh I see we we're thinking the same... ghosts go faster over time should max out at 5% faster than Pac after 40-70 seconds depending on the color... reds fastest.
  • zardOz2: @x32g: I just changed the scoring... last time today lol I promise
  • x32g: Now 230
  • x32g: Also my high score is 151.
  • x32g: This could win a contest by it self right now! Just make the ghosts go faster every few seconds.
  • zardOz2: @x32g: @FirePhenixFire: just made a temporary game to play, try again!
  • x32g: Cool!
  • FirePhenixFire: I didn't realize that you could hold it down :D
  • FirePhenixFire: @zardOz: good point
  • zardOz2: ..can't use it..
  • zardOz2: @FirePhenixFire: well currently it's designed like the arcade controls where you would need to hold the joystick in the direction you want to go or tap at just the right moment. I wanted to put it on a single dial but the PC players can use it very good.
  • FirePhenixFire: Could you make it remember the controls then go in that direction when it comes to a intersection
  • zardOz2: @The_Blacksmith_: @FirePhenixFire: @sjoerd1999: thanks, this will probably the last one before I have a game working...
  • sjoerd19992: Nice, cowboy pac?! Nice work!!
  • FirePhenixFire: Cant wait to play the finished game :D
  • The_Blacksmith_: @zardOz: no lag on my s4. Nice job! LIKE
  • zardOz2: @Demon666: heh, well they are only 2 texels wide so it might look weird... anyway I gotta get mr or mrs pacman in first and see where the speed is
  • Demon666: yeah the little things that are in place of its feet
  • zardOz2: @Demon666: tentacles?
  • Demon666: even better. try making the tentacles move lol
  • spyninja242001: @zardOz: not laggy at all for my IPAd mini
  • zardOz2: @TechZ: thanks, I'll keep working with it!
  • TechZ2124: Great one ! Doesn't lag for me on android with a Dual-Core 1.7 GHz Processor. I wait for the upgrades !
  • zardOz2: @Cralant: thanks will do
  • zardOz2: If someone could verify that this does NOT lag on PC
  • Cralant: Ahh OK, well if you need a hand with anything let me know :)
  • zardOz2: @principia_rus: @Wkmz: @Cubic_212: @Alfajim: ty all! @Cralant: I can proably pull off the AI but this isnt goint anywhere until I can optimise the code, this is alrready slowing for me
  • Wkmz: Wow....
  • Cralant: Nice job z, if you want I could show you how best to make your ghosts have some ai, shouldn't be too complicated because of the one wide corridors.
  • principia_rus: wow! cool lua work!
  • Alfajim: Wow! Its looking great so far. :)
  • Cubic_212: Very nice ! Continue like this and you will make a wonderful game !
  • zardOz2: @FirePhenixFire: thx, naturally I screwed them up since I didnt look at a picture first... the whites are supposed to be centered on up/down movement, Im totally not fixing that lol
  • FirePhenixFire: Nice like the eyes looks good :D
  • zardOz2: @Demon666: yeah that part really sucked I couldnt find an easy way so I had to make 20 set specific texel lines for each of the 4 directions... @Rubicon: @electro: thanks all credits to Midway games ;)
  • Demon666: WHAT TOOK YOU SO LONG?! jp lmao really nice so far! i love how you even made its eyes turn when hes changing direction.
  • Rubicon2: Looks awesome so far
  • electro: Cool

